Block

#21,658,576
Block Number
21,658,576 @ 05/13/2025, 05:42:10
Status
Finalized
ID
0x014a7bd07e481be5b94c754b71bbd7256d91f40da984087367af461ff749bc8b
Transactions
Gas Used
5082729/40000000 (12.71% Used)
Total Score
2,115,196,669 (+99)
Rewards
17.08 VTHO